Her first album was released in 1993 and was named ''Ilha d'Sal.'' Her second solo album ''D'zencontre'' was recorded in Lisbon in 1995 with top local musicians.

She took part in a spectacle in honor of "Cesária Évora and Friends", which toured other countries including England, Switzerland, Sweden, Germany, France, China at the Shanghai Expo, etc. She recorded a CD in Paris.
